Why am I being charged a fee on my SGD transaction with amaze?

While foreign currency transactions are completely fee-free, there’s a small
1% fee on domestic transactions (minimum 0.50 SGD) when amaze is linked to
your debit or credit card. This helps ensure that we can continue offering
you the best travel card experience and competitive foreign exchange rates
while managing other costs.
